Summary, etc.: | Three goldfish live in a small bowl, in an apartment building, in the middle of a big city, until one summer they get to go on vacation--in a fountain, with lily pads, and reeds, and other neighborhood goldfish. |
Awards Note: | Charter Oak Children’s Book Award (COCBA) Nominee, 2018-2019. |

Sally Lloyd-Jones is the author of the New York Times bestseller How to Be a Baby . . . by Me, the Big Sister and its companions, How to Get Married . . . by Me, the Bride and How to Get a Job . . . by Me, the Boss . She has written many other books for children, including Poor Doreen and The House That's Your Home . She spent her childhood in Africa and England and now lives in New York City. Leo Espinosa received the Founder's Award from the Society of Illustrators for Jackrabbit McCabe and the Electric Telegraph, which was also a Bank Street College of Education Best Book of the Year. His illustrations have graced the pages of the New Yorker, Wired, Esquire, and the New York Times, among many other publications. He is also a commercial artist whose work can be seen on toys, games, stationery, and clothing. Originally from Bogotá, Colombia, he lives with his family in Salt Lake City.
